前言
无论是在学习中还是在以后的工作中,我们都需要通过做一些经典的项目来巩固自己的计算
机基础知识,github是一个比较受欢迎的一个开源项目平台,里面包含了优秀的案例,例如服务
器,深度学习等方面的项目,但是在我们访问github的时候,就会出现以下错误:github打不开,
现在就这一情况作如下描述。
一、Github出错的原因
我们在访问github的官网时,是直接访问域名也即github.com,域名是一个要通过DNS解析
的过程,将域名解析为对应的ip地址(有关DNS的相关知识点在这里http://t.csdn.cn/dR8UV),所
以说大部分的时间都花在了这里,这才造成了github打不开的情况或者访问比较慢。
二、解决办法
1.修改hosts文件
1.1 打开文件:
hosts文件地址
1.2 添加ip地址
20.205.243.166 github.com
# GitHub Start
140.82.114.4 github.com
199.232.69.194 github.global.ssl.fastly.net
# GitHub End
1.3 dns刷新
首先Win+R窗口打开,在输入cmd,其次输入以下命令:
ipconfig/flushdns
此时打开github的速度快了许多,一般情况下不出十秒就会打开了。
2.Github镜像
正所谓通往罗马的路不止一条,我们进入到github平台的目的是将相应的项目拉取下来,也就是
下载项目的压缩包,也就是说只要能下载下来就好了,其他的不用多问。
这里推荐Github镜像的方法:
https://www.gitclone.com/
在上述平台下,我们只要将项目的链接地址复制粘贴上去点击搜索,结果如下图所示:
我们可以新建一个文件夹,用来存储上面的项目,文件夹建立好之后,打开Windows窗口,进
入到刚才建立的文件夹,复制克隆地址,稍等片刻就会下载完成了。
总结
以上就是今天要讲的内容,本文仅仅简单介绍了github访问较慢的原因,进而给出相应的解决办
法,这里值得注意的是,我们不要把眼光聚集在github上,其实Gitee.com也是一个不错的代码托
管平台,链接地址如下:https://toscode.gitee.com/,无论是学习上还是生活中遇到的问题只要不
急,总能找到解决问题的办法,如果暂时找不到的话,不妨与身边的朋友们交谈一下,共同寻找解
决问题的办法,与君共勉!
版权归原作者 abc115211 所有, 如有侵权,请联系我们删除。